Output 18a0ea39e5e24e8e51f61e7267e080da18fefdf7b3b7ed979475331817d08b01:4

value
10736594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51b2535cb978cdd7f167c76472e99de37a0c915 OP_EQUAL
address
3JCckMfqYeDVvzBZRuFqBDk9AV67T6bs7Y
transaction
18a0ea39e5e24e8e51f61e7267e080da18fefdf7b3b7ed979475331817d08b01
spent
true